Understanding Auto Transport Insurance: Protecting Your Investment

Shipping a car involves inherent risks, even with the most experienced carrier. That’s why understanding your insurance coverage is crucial. Before your car even hits the road, make sure you’re fully aware of these key aspects:

  1. Carrier Liability Coverage: The Foundation of Protection: All reputable auto transport companies, including Overbrook Auto Transport, carry liability insurance mandated by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A). This coverage protects you if damage occurs due to the carrier’s negligence. Don’t hesitate to ask for a copy of the carrier’s insurance certificate for your records – at Overbrook, we’re happy to provide this documentation and answer any questions you may have.   2. Cargo Insurance: Shielding Your Vehicle from the Unexpected: While carrier liability covers damage due to negligence, cargo insurance provides broader protection against unforeseen events like natural disasters, vandalism, or theft.   3. Gap Coverage: Bridging the Financial Gap: In some cases, carrier liability and cargo insurance may not fully cover the total value of your vehicle, especially for newer models or those with outstanding loans. Gap coverage bridges this potential shortfall, ensuring you’re fully reimbursed in the event of a total loss.   4. Understanding Your Own Auto Insurance Policy: Review your personal auto insurance policy carefully. It may offer some level of coverage during transit, but this often depends on the specific terms and conditions. Clarifying this with your insurer beforehand will prevent any surprises. Some policies might suspend coverage if your car is being transported commercially. We recommend contacting your insurer to understand how your policy applies to vehicle shipping scenarios.

Proactive Steps: Minimizing Risk and Ensuring a Smooth Transport

While insurance provides crucial financial protection, preventing damage in the first place is always the best approach. Overbrook Auto Transport adheres to rigorous safety protocols, but these proactive steps on your part will further minimize risk and ensure a smooth transport experience:

  1. Thorough Vehicle Inspection: Documenting the Pre-Existing Condition: Before handing over your keys, conduct a meticulous inspection of your car, meticulously documenting any existing scratches, dents, dings, or other imperfections. Take clear photos and videos from multiple angles, capturing every detail. This crucial step helps distinguish pre-existing damage from any that may occur during transit, protecting both you and the carrier.
  2. Remove Personal Belongings: Protecting Your Valuables and Your Car: Do not leave any valuable or personal items inside your car. This not only protects your belongings but also reduces the risk of theft and potential damage to your car’s interior. Items shifting during transit can scratch surfaces or cause other damage. Overbrook’s policy prohibits shipping personal belongings for both safety and liability reasons, so please plan accordingly.
  3. Disable Alarms and Anti-Theft Devices: Avoiding Unnecessary Disruptions: Deactivate any alarms or anti-theft systems that might be triggered during transport. This avoids unnecessary delays, potential disruptions to the carrier’s schedule, and prevents the battery from draining. If you’re unsure how to disable your alarm, consult your vehicle’s owner’s manual.
  4. Secure Loose Parts: Preventing Damage to Exterior Components: Ensure any loose parts, such as spoilers, antennas, or convertible tops, are securely fastened or removed to prevent damage during transit. These parts can be vulnerable to wind resistance and vibrations during transport, so taking this precaution is essential.
  5. Fuel Level: The Right Balance for Transport: Keep your fuel tank at approximately one-quarter full. This minimizes weight, improving fuel efficiency for the carrier, while providing enough fuel for loading and unloading at the destination.
  6. Clean Your Car: Facilitating a Clear Inspection Process: While not essential for damage prevention, a clean car allows for a more accurate assessment of its condition both before and after transport. It also makes the inspection process smoother and helps identify any potential damage more easily.
  7. Maintain Proper Tire Pressure: Ensuring Safety and Performance: Check your tire pressure and ensure it’s within the recommended range for optimal performance and safety during transport. Correct tire pressure helps prevent uneven wear and tear and ensures the vehicle is transported safely on the carrier.
  8. Address Mechanical Issues: Informing Us of Any Pre-Existing Problems: If your car has any existing mechanical problems, such as leaks, unusual noises, or difficulty starting, inform Overbrook Auto Transport beforehand. This allows us to take the necessary precautions during loading, transport, and unloading, ensuring your vehicle is handled with the appropriate care. Open vs. Enclosed Transport: Choosing the Right Level of Protection

One key decision you’ll need to make is choosing between open and enclosed auto transport. Each option offers different levels of protection and cost considerations:

  • Open Transport: The Cost-Effective Choice: This is the most common and cost-effective method, involving transporting your vehicle on an open carrier, similar to those used for transporting new cars to dealerships. While open transport exposes your vehicle to the elements, Overbrook Auto Transport takes every precaution to minimize risk, including securing your vehicle properly and utilizing experienced drivers.
  • Enclosed Transport: Maximum Protection for Your Vehicle: This premium option provides maximum protection from weather, road debris, and other potential hazards. Your vehicle is shipped inside a fully enclosed trailer, shielding it from the outside environment. While more expensive than open transport, enclosed transport is ideal for classic cars, luxury vehicles, or those requiring extra care and protection.

Post-Transport Inspection: Ensuring Your Vehicle Arrives as Expected

Once your vehicle arrives, another thorough inspection is essential. Carefully compare its condition to your pre-shipping documentation, noting any discrepancies. Pay close attention to the areas you documented in your initial inspection. If you notice any damage, immediately report it to the driver and Overbrook Auto Transport.
